3. Tax Optimization Services
Let’s face it, taxes can be as thrilling as watching paint dry. But for your event management business, tax optimization isn’t just about avoiding headaches—it’s about unlocking hidden financial potential.
The Power of Smart Tax Strategies
- Deduction Maximization: Did you know that the average small business could save up to 19% on taxes by utilizing all eligible deductions? (Source: SBA) By strategically planning these deductions, you can reinvest in your business or throw a bigger budget at those jaw-dropping corporate events you’re known for.
- Tax Credits Utilization: Many businesses leave money on the table by not claiming available tax credits. Whether it’s energy efficiency credits or hiring incentives, knowing which ones apply to your operations can significantly lower your tax bill.
- Entity Structuring: Choosing the right business structure—be it LLC, S-Corp, or something else—can influence your tax liabilities and shield more of your hard-earned revenue. Who knew a little paperwork could save so much?

The Three Musketeers of Risk Management: Identification, Analysis, and Action
- Risk Identification: This is the first step where you metaphorically put on your detective hat. Evaluate potential risks like vendor reliability, weather unpredictability (because who doesn’t love an unexpected rainstorm at an outdoor gala?), or even financial pitfalls like fluctuating costs due to economic changes.
- Risk Analysis: Once identified, it’s time to weigh these risks like a pro. Consider their potential impact on your business and how likely they are to occur. This helps prioritize which risks need more attention—think of it as triage for potential disasters.
- Action Planning: Finally, develop strategies to mitigate these risks. This could involve diversifying vendors or securing insurance policies designed specifically for events—because nobody wants their dream event turned into a nightmare by an unforeseen mishap.

Why You Need Debt Management Consulting
- Structured Repayment Plans: Consultants can craft tailored repayment plans that fit your cash flow cycle, making sure you’re not living on ramen because of unrealistic payment schedules.
- Interest Rate Negotiation: Expertise in negotiating lower interest rates can save you substantial amounts over time, freeing up resources for investing back into your business.
- Avoiding Financial Pitfalls: With professional guidance, you’ll dodge common debt traps like balloon payments and hidden fees that could cripple your finances.
